Muckross

Decided to wear Inov8s this evening in anticipation of muddy tracks, BAD DECISION. As it turns out they were fine, recent weather had dried them a bit, and then to compound matters my torch battery died so had to adjust my route home.

Torch just stopped on the descent from the high point so switched it back on again, died, so then tried the lower setting and that stayed on until the Old Kenmare Road. Decided to turn around then and take the road home. Fished back-up torch out of the pocket, doesn't really shed much light on things. Headed down the road from the Upper Torc Car Park. Was thinking of going all the way around on the Main Road but with my running gear this evening, including tights, all black, decided to take a short cut in along the low track coming out on my side of Blue Pool. Did have a reflective arm band that also flashes.

Tried the torch after coming off the road and it lasted a minute. Track was grand to run on but not much light. Think I upped the pace on the climb home.

Calves were a bit sore running, so really undecided on what to do training wise tomorrow. Legs also felt a bit tired. Option would be to turbo tomorrow, run Thursday and also turbo Friday. Turbo would at least allow some recovery time. Will pack gear for a track session and decide at some stage.
